    DRI seizes Rs 62.26L in foreign currency

    The Directorate of Revenue Intelligence on Friday seized Rs. 62.26 lakh worth assorted foreign currencies at the Chennai airport from five passengers bound for Colombo.

    Chennai

    The DRI team profiled 27 passengers on information regarding currency smuggling and found five out of them were trying to smuggled out assorted foreign currencies like US dollars, Euros, Singapore dollars and Thailand bhat.

    The carriers had told the DRI team that money was handed over to them outside Chennai airport, offering financial benefit for carrying it to Colombo. The smugglers said they were directed to hand over the currency to persons on board the flight to Colombo. The currency notes were meant to be smuggled to Singapore via Colombo.

    Similarly, another DRI team seized 1.2 kg gold bars from a passenger who landed at Tiruchy airport. The passenger was carrying 12 gold bars, each weighing 100 grams in a passport holder. The officials then seized the gold and arrested the smuggler.
